Walking Pad For Desk

A walking pad is an excellent method of tracking your daily steps for those who have limited space. The most effective models can be folded 180 degrees to fit under furniture in a closet or under the couch.

These portable treadmills tend to be smaller and more affordable than full-sized treadmills. Many portable treadmills have wheels to make them easier to move around and put away when not in use.

Space-Saving Design

In contrast to traditional treadmill desks which are specifically designed for full-body workouts walking pads take up less space and allow you to move your body as you work. They are also more quiet and a good option for those who wish to exercise without disrupting their work. They are also easy to use and are easy to store when not being used.

When shopping for a walking pads for under desk pad, make sure to examine the dimensions before buying. You may have to think of a different way to store you store your walking pad, as certain models require the handle to be raised during use and may not be able to fit under certain desks. Check the height of the treadmill folded if you intend to store it under furniture that has an unflattering clearance.

It is crucial to set realistic goals when using a mat for walking. You must walk at a pace that doesn't interfere with your work. You can always slow down when necessary. It is also beneficial to put a cushion beneath your feet to avoid discomfort in your joints.

The WalkingPad P1 Foldable Walking Treadmill is one of the easiest under-desk treadmills to use and set up. It folds down to 32.5 21.5 inches. 21.5 inches and features wheels on the bottom, making it easy to move and tuck away. It also comes with an remote and LED screen that shows the speed of the machine, its distance, and the burned calories.

The WalkingPad R2 is an excellent option if you're seeking a more advanced under-desk walkpad. It can travel at speeds of up to 8 mph and comes with an adjustable incline. It also has 12 high-impact interval training programs (HIIT).

The under-desk pad is easy to use and simple to use. It comes with the ability to control it remotely and an LED display that displays the distance as well as the speed and calories burned. It's compatible with fitness apps such as Fitbit and Apple Health, and has an ear-splitting noise reduction feature that prevents it from distracting others in the room. It also has a 360 degree fold, making it easy to carry and then tuck away when not in use.

Walking pads, also referred to as under desk treadmills, are a cost-effective and simple method of adding more exercise to your daily routine. While they may not offer as much flexibility as a large treadmill, they're an excellent option for those who need to keep their steps in at work, but do not have the space to dedicate to a dedicated fitness machine.

When shopping for an under desk treadmill that folds be sure to keep in mind a few things. Consider your budget and the features you want in a walking mat. For instance, if going to be using it at work, it's crucial to think about the noise level and whether or not it's quiet enough to be professional. Another thing to consider is the maximum speed of the machine and if it allows running and jogging.
